Causes of Circular Saw Sparking

There are several factors that can contribute to a circular saw sparking, including worn brushes, damaged windings, worn bearings, dust or debris, and cutting metal. Each of these issues can lead to sparks flying during saw operation, posing a potential safety hazard.

Firstly, worn brushes are a common cause of sparking. Over time, the brushes in a circular saw can become worn down, resulting in a poor electrical connection. This can lead to arcing and sparks. If you notice your saw sparking, it is crucial to inspect the brushes and replace them promptly if they are worn.

Additionally, damaged windings or worn bearings can also cause sparks. When the windings or bearings in the saw’s motor are compromised, the electrical current may not flow smoothly, resulting in sparks. Regular maintenance and inspection of these components is vital to prevent sparking issues.

Another common culprit is the accumulation of dust or debris inside the saw. Sawdust and other particles can cause electrical arcing and sparks, especially when they come into contact with the motor or the blade. Regular cleaning of the saw, including the motor vents and blade area, can help prevent this issue. It is also important to operate the saw in a clean and clear work area to minimize the amount of debris that can enter the tool.

Troubleshooting Circular Saw Sparking

If you’re experiencing sparks with your circular saw, there are steps you can take to troubleshoot the issue and prevent further occurrences. Sparks can be caused by a variety of factors, including worn brushes, damaged windings, worn bearings, dust or debris, cutting metal, improper use, grounding faults, and defective saws.

Here are some troubleshooting tips to address circular saw sparking:

  1. Inspect the brushes: Worn brushes can cause sparking. Check the condition of the brushes and replace them promptly if they are worn. Regular maintenance of the brushes is essential to prevent damage to the motor and ensure smooth operation.
  2. Clean the saw: Dust and debris can accumulate inside the saw and lead to sparking. Regular cleaning is necessary to remove any build-up. Pay attention to the areas around the brushes and vents, as they tend to accumulate the most debris.
  3. Avoid contact with foreign objects: Sparks can occur if the blade contacts objects it shouldn’t, such as nails or screws. Always ensure the work area is clear of any potential hazards, and be cautious when cutting near walls or other surfaces that may hide hidden objects.
  4. Check for grounding faults: Improper grounding can contribute to sparks. Ensure that the saw is properly grounded by using a three-pronged plug and an outlet with a ground connection. Regularly inspect the power cord for any damage.
  5. Inspect for defects: Defective saws can also cause sparking. Check for any visible damage or signs of wear on the saw, such as loose parts or frayed wires. If you notice any defects, it’s essential to have the saw repaired or replaced.

Worn Brushes and Sparking

Worn brushes are a common culprit behind circular saw sparking, highlighting the necessity of regular maintenance and timely brush replacement. Over time, the brushes in a circular saw can become worn down due to extended use. These brushes are responsible for delivering electrical current to the motor, and when they become too worn, they can cause sparks to fly.

To prevent this issue, it is important to inspect the brushes regularly and replace them when necessary. Most circular saws have easily accessible brush holders that allow for quick replacement. By keeping the brushes in good condition, you can avoid potential damage to the motor and ensure smooth, spark-free operation of your saw.

Grounding Faults and Defective Saws

Grounding faults and defective saws can contribute to sparking, underscoring the significance of proper grounding and routine tool inspection. Without sufficient grounding, the electrical charge generated by the saw can build up, leading to sparks. This can be particularly dangerous in environments with flammable materials or in the presence of volatile gases.

Regularly inspecting the circular saw for any defects or damage is crucial to ensure safe operation. Frayed cords, loose connections, or any visible signs of wear should be addressed immediately. It is also important to check for any loose or damaged components that may affect the saw’s performance and increase the risk of sparking.

To maintain proper grounding, ensure that the circular saw is connected to a properly grounded power source. A grounding plug with a three-pronged plug should be used, and the outlet should be in good working order. If you suspect a grounding fault, it is recommended to consult a qualified electrician for further assessment and repair.

Can a Hot Circular Saw Motor Cause Sparks?

Yes, a circular saw motor overheating can indeed cause sparks. When a circular saw motor becomes excessively hot, the insulation around its wires may degrade, leading to short circuits. These short circuits generate sparks, which could potentially ignite surrounding flammable materials. It is crucial to monitor and prevent circular saw motor overheating to ensure safety during operation.
